Is Trader Joe's Sliced Prosciutto Dairy Free?

Description
Thin, delicate slices offer a silky, slightly salty, umami-forward flavor and tender, melt-in-mouth texture. Common uses include charcuterie boards, sandwiches, wrapping around melon or asparagus, and topping salads or pizzas. Reviewers commonly note consistent thinness and rich taste, while some mention variability in saltiness and slice moisture levels occasionally too.

Ingredients
ham, salt.
What is a Dairy Free diet?
A dairy-free diet eliminates all foods made from or containing milk and milk-derived ingredients, such as butter, cheese, yogurt, and cream. It's essential for people with lactose intolerance, milk allergies, or those who prefer plant-based alternatives. Common dairy substitutes include almond, soy, oat, and coconut-based milks and cheeses. While dairy is a major source of calcium and vitamin D, these nutrients can be replaced through fortified foods or supplements. Many people find going dairy-free helps reduce digestive issues, acne, or inflammation, but balance and proper nutrient intake remain key for long-term health.
